Guruvayur (Kerala), May 24 (PTI) Kerala Chief Minister V D Satheesan on Sunday visited the famous Guruvayur Sree Krishna Temple here and offered prayers.
The chief minister also performed the traditional ‘tulabharam’ ritual using butter as an offering, according to a post shared by the Guruvayur Devaswom on Facebook.
This was the chief minister’s first visit to the temple after assuming office, it said.
Satheesan reached the temple around 7 am and was received by Devaswom chairman A V Gopinath and administrator O B Arun Kumar. The Devaswom chairman welcomed him by presenting a shawl, it said.
Around 71 kg of butter was used for the tulabharam offering, the post said.
The chief minister is a regular devotee who visits the temple once every month, it added.
Later, Satheesan also attended the wedding ceremony of the son of Revenue Minister A P Anil Kumar at the shrine premises. PTI LGK ADB
